Mississippi (MS) was admitted to the Union as the 20th state on December 10, 1817. Nicknamed the "The Magnolia State," Mississippi is the 32nd largest state by geographic size (at 48,434 sq mi/125,443 sq km) and 31st largest by population. The capital city of Mississippi is Jackson, the largest city is Jackson, and the highest point is Woodall Mountain at 806 ft/246 m.
